Frame: Solid wood, with elegantly and well-proportioned turned legs, typical of rustic furniture from the 19th or early 20th century.
• Top: Exposed natural wood, likely walnut or antique fir, with a varnish that highlights the original grain.
• Legs and under-top panel: Painted in aanthracite grey , with slight irregularities that reveal the hand-finished finish.
• Central drawer: Recessed into the front panel, with a brass metal handle, useful for storing objects or stationery when used as a desk.
Dating and Provenance
The table appears to be an original piece from the second half of the 19th or early 20th century, from Italy or France. The restoration was carried out with a decorative focus, with the addition of a anthracite gray to enhance its appearance and make it more contemporary.
